𝑉𝐶𝐶 = 3𝑉 (operating voltage)
𝐺

= 40000 (sensor gain)

The number of bits for each channel depends on the resolution of the Analog-to-Digital
Converter (ADC); in biosignalsplux the default is 16-bit resolution (𝑛 = 16), although 12-bit
(𝑛 = 12) and 8-bit (𝑛 = 8) may also be found.
